A new take on classic rock, plus a fun after-party

Couldn’t get your hands on tickets to Girl Talk tonight? Settle for the “Totally Non-Exclusive, Absolutely Unofficial” after-party at DC9. It starts at 9, and it’s free with a ticket stub, $5 without.

The Life, Rhythm, and Move Project, led by Aysha Upchurch, combines urban dance and spoken word. Catch a free performance at the Kennedy Center’s Millennium Stage at 6.

Former Led Zeppelin guitarist Robert Plant and the Band of Joy—featuring singer Patty Griffin—are playing at DAR Constitution Hall. The North Mississippi Allstars are the opening act. 7 PM; get tickets ($53.50) at Ticketmaster.
